2017-02-01 14 views
1

には、コードネーム1の「サインインしてください」機能を実装する方法のサンプルがありますか?私はそれが暗号化されたストレージ機能とおそらく他の何かをお勧めですか?サンプルコード

Preferences.set("username", myUserName); 

その後、後で上のコードで:あなたがしたいが、一般的に、あなただけのユーザー名/パスワードの組み合わせを維持したい場合は、単に行うことができれば

答えて

1

あなたはstorage encryptionを使用することができます

if(Preferences.get("username") != null) { 
    // use the username from preferences 
} 
+0

を環境設定でパスワードを保存するのは安全ですか?私はキーチェーンのようなものを使うべきではありませんか? – feci

+0

そのため、私はより安全なストレージ暗号化へのリンクを提供しました。 AppleのキーチェーンはApple独自のもので、他のOSでは使用できませんので、同様の機能を公開しません。 –

+0

私は私が従うか分からない。 1.)ユーザーがサインインして、私を歌い続けるのを選択する2.)パスワードでストレージを暗号化する3.アプリケーションが完全に閉じられる4.)ユーザーがアプリケーションを開くと、 )、どのようにパスワードを取得するのですか?ストレージがパスワードで暗号化されているときに、私は知らず、ユーザーに尋ねることもできません。 – feci

関連する問題